Malcolm Fraser

Prime Minister of Australia from 1975 to 1983

For other people named Malcolm Fraser, see Malcolm Fraser (disambiguation).

John Malcolm FraserAC CH GCL PC (; 21 May 1930 – 20 March 2015) was an Australian politician who served as the 22nd prime minister of Australia from 1975 to 1983.

He held office as the leader of the Liberal Party of Australia, and is the fourth longest-serving prime minister in Australian history.

Fraser was raised on his father's sheep stations, and after studying at Magdalen College, Oxford, returned to Australia to take over the family property in the Western District of Victoria.
